project.js 688 B

12345678910111213141516171819202122
  1. let flags = globalThis.flags;
  2. flags.name = 'ArmorPad';
  3. flags.package = 'org.armorpad';
  4. flags.with_minits = true;
  5. flags.with_nfd = true;
  6. flags.with_tinydir = true;
  7. flags.with_g2 = true;
  8. flags.with_iron = true;
  9. flags.with_zui = true;
  10. flags.on_c_project_created = function(c_project, platform, graphics) {
  11. c_project.addDefine('IDLE_SLEEP');
  12. }
  13. let project = new Project("ArmorPad");
  14. let root = "../../";
  15. project.addSources("Sources");
  16. project.addShaders(root + "armorcore/Shaders/*.glsl",);
  17. project.addAssets(root + "base/Assets/font_mono.ttf", { destination: "data/{name}" });
  18. project.addAssets(root + "base/Assets/text_coloring.json", { destination: "data/{name}" });
  19. resolve(project);